Virtual Senior Center Connects Homebound Seniors to Community and Family -- NEW YORK, March 10 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 --
prnewswire.com — “Virtual Senior Center Connects Homebound Seniors to Community and Family. A demonstration project developed by Microsoft, the city of New York and Selfhelp Community Services shows how technology can reduce social isolation, increase wellness and enhance quality of life for homebound seniors.” View full resource at prnewswire.com
